www NSP Portal: National Scholarship Portal (NSP) 2022-23 is a digital gateway for different government scholarship schemes offered by Central governments, State Governments and other government agencies like UGC and AICTE. It is a one-stop platform for students who are interested in applying for various educational schemes and scholarship services. The portal looks after end to end implementation of the scholarship schemes and their disbursement as well. www nsp portal gov in

The National Scholarship Portal hosts 118 scholarship schemes worth hundreds of crores for the scholarship seekers registered on the platform. It is taken as a ‘Mission Mode Project’ under the National e-Governance Plan (NeGP). As per the data released for the academic year 2022-23, NSP has helped the government implement and disburse scholarships worth more than INR 2,800 crores (INR 2875.50 to be precise). The platform boasts more than 127 lakh applications out of which over 84 Lakh applications are verified.

What is the National Scholarship Portal (NSP)?

National Scholarship Portal (NSP) is one of the most prominent scholarship portals launched by the Ministry of Electronics and Information Technology, Government of India. So it offers various scholarship schemes to SC/ ST/ OBC/ Minority and General category students. NSP ensures timely disbursement of scholarships to students and avoids duplication in processing.

Its main aim is to create a transparent database of scholars and ensure that the scholarships are disbursed through Direct Benefit Transfer (DBT) to eligible students.

Benefits of NSP

There are several benefits that eligible students can avail themselves from the National Scholarship Portal, which are:

  • NSP simplifies the scholarship process as the information is available under one umbrella.
  • It, being a single integrated application for all scholarships, ensures that students don’t have to scale other websites to know about eligibility or the application process.
  • It helps to reduce the duplication of applications.
  • NSP suggests the appropriate schemes for students.
  • So it serves as a Decision Support System (DSS) for various Ministries and departments, providing up-to-date information on demand.
  • It ensures faster scholarship processing.
  • Also, it helps standardize master data for all India-level courses and institutions.

Why was the National Scholarship Portal (NSP) Created?

The National Scholarship Portal was started by the Indian government under the National e-Governance initiative to ensure a smooth and proper flow of funds directly to the bank accounts of students without any hindrance. The key objectives behind the creation of this National Scholarship Portal include –

  • Ensuring the application of DBT (Direct Benefit Transfer)
  • Avoiding duplication that occurs while processing the applications
  • Offering the students, a common platform for both Central and State Government scholarships
  • Harmonizing the variety of scholarships and their norms
  • Creating a transparent scholars’ database
  • Ensuring all scholarships are disbursed to students on time

How to Apply at National Scholarship Portal (NSP) 2022-23?

To avail of various scholarships and help students apply for them, one needs to register on NSP. Students must know how to apply through the scholarship portal.

However, before applying for a scholarship, the students need to make sure that their current educational institution is registered on the portal. So if the institution is not registered on the portal, the student would not be able to apply for any scholarship. The portal also has the provision for the institutions to register themselves, if not already registered.

Candidates must follow the below steps to apply for an NSP scholarship through the national scholarship portal.

Step 1: Searching for the Institute

  • Visit the official website of NSP.
  • Then click on the ‘Search for Institute‘ button.
  • Fill in the required details and get the institution list.
  • So if the institution is not registered, the candidates can request their institutions to register on the portal by clicking here.

Step 2: Registering with National Scholarship Portal (NSP)

  • All fresh users need to visit the Home Page of the National Scholarship Portal to register.
  • Then click on ‘New Registration’.
  • Select the desired option
  • A page of Guidelines for Registration on NSP will open.
  • Also, go through the guidelines carefully.
  • Click on ‘Continue’ to proceed.
  • Fill in all required details.
  • Then click on ‘Register’.
  • A student application ID and password will be sent to the registered mobile number.

Step 3: Logging in with National Scholarship Portal

  • Click on the login tab.
  • Then enter the application ID and password received on the registered number.

Step 4: Change the Password (Mandatory Step)

  • Upon successful login, the applicant will receive an OTP on their registered mobile number.
  • Then verify the OTP.
  • The applicant will be directed to change the password page.
  • Change the password and continue.

Step 5: Enter the Dashboard

  • Once the password is changed, the student will be directed to the Applicant’s Dashboard Page.
  • Then click on ‘Application Form to start the application.
  • Fill in all registration details, academic details and other necessary details.
  • Also, click on ‘Save & Continue.
  • Add contact details, and scheme details and upload necessary documents.
  • Click on ‘Save as Draft’ (To confirm if you have entered the correct information)
  • Once confirmed, click on the ‘Final Submit’ tab.

Note: The applications finally submitted cannot be edited again. So, the applicants are advised to be double sure while clicking on final submission as no change of information will be entertained after final submission.

National Scholarship Portal (NSP) – Key Documents Required

While applying for any scholarship on NSP, the students are required to upload certain documents to complete the application process. However, for the scholarship amount less than INR 50,000, the students are not required to upload any document. They need to submit a copy of the documents to their respective schools/colleges/institute.

For all other scholarships, the students should keep the following documents ready:

  • Aadhaar Card
  • Bank Passbook
  • Educational documents
  • Domicile Certificate (as specified in the respective scholarship guidelines)
  • Income Certificate (as specified in the respective scholarship guidelines)
  • Caste Certificate (if the candidate belongs to a special category)
  • Bonafide student certificate from school/institute (if the institute/school is different from the domicile state of the applicant)
  • Self-declaration certificate
  • Photograph of the candidate
  • Candidate’s mobile number

FAQs on www NSP Portal

When can a student apply for NSP scholarships?

The application period for each NSP scholarship varies. The applications for centrally funded scholarships generally start in August and continue till November. However, there is no specific timeline for state scholarships. To know about the respective application period, kindly refer to the list of scholarships in the article above.

Is Aadhaar a mandatory requirement for all NSP scholarships?

No, an Aadhaar number is not a mandatory requirement to apply for any NSP scholarship. If the students do not have an Aadhaar number, they can still apply for the scholarships by providing the Aadhaar enrollment id.

Where can the students apply for NSP scholarship renewal?

The students applying for renewal are required to apply through the NSP login page. So they need to visit the home page of NSP and click on the ‘login’ tab. The login pages for fresh and renewal applications differ for each academic year. So, students must be careful to select the renewal tab and log in using their registered application ID and password to proceed with the application renewal process.

Can a student edit the form after final submission?

No. Once the applicant submits the application form, no changes in information will be entertained. So, it is always advisable to properly check the application form before final submission.
